Asian and Islamic Architecture

While Western architecture developed from Classical roots, profound and highly sophisticated architectural traditions evolved concurrently across Asia and the Islamic world. These traditions were shaped by distinct religious philosophies (Hinduism, Buddhism, Islam, Shintoism, Daoism), unique environmental challenges, and different fundamental approaches to structural engineering, such as intricate timber framing and complex geometry.

Indian Architecture

Indian architecture is deeply rooted in religious cosmology. The design of temples (Hindu, Buddhist, Jain) is governed by sacred geometry and ancient treatises called the Vastu Shastra, which align buildings with astronomical events and cosmic energy.

Key Features of Indian Architecture

  • The Stupa: The foundational Buddhist monument. Originally a simple earth mound containing relics of the Buddha, it evolved into a massive hemispherical dome (e.g., the Great Stupa at Sanchi) symbolizing the cosmos. It features a circumambulatory pathway for ritual walking (pradakshina).
  • Hindu Temple Architecture: Temples are designed as microcosms of the universe and residences for deities. They are characterized by a small, dark, womb-like inner sanctuary (garbhagriha) housing the deity, topped by a towering, mountain-like superstructure (shikhara in the North, vimana in the South).
  • Mandapa: The pillared hall or pavilion preceding the garbhagriha in a Hindu temple, serving as a gathering space for worshippers, ritual dancing, and public rituals.
  • Gopuram: Found primarily in Dravidian (Southern Indian) temple architecture, this is a massive, heavily ornate, and tapering entrance tower leading into the temple compound. They often became larger than the main sanctuary itself and were heavily sculpted with deities and mythological scenes.
  • Rock-Cut Architecture: Vast, intricate temple complexes carved entirely out of solid cliff faces, such as the Ellora and Ajanta Caves. The Kailasanatha Temple at Ellora is a monolithic marvel, excavated top-down from a single rock outcropping to imitate Mount Kailash.
  • Vastu Purusha Mandala: A metaphysical square grid plan used in Hindu temple design, representing the cosmos, with the central square dedicated to Brahma.

Sikh Architecture

Emerging primarily in the Punjab region, Sikh architecture developed as a distinct synthesis of Mughal and Rajput styles, adapted for congregational worship and an ethos of openness.

Key Features of Sikh Architecture

  • The Gurdwara: The Sikh place of worship, meaning "door to the Guru." Unlike many Hindu temples with restricted inner sanctums, gurdwaras are designed with entrances on all four sides to symbolize openness to people of all castes, creeds, and directions.
  • The Golden Temple (Harmandir Sahib): The spiritual center of Sikhism in Amritsar. It embodies the style, featuring a lower-level marble structure set within a sacred pool (sarovar), an upper level covered in gold leaf, and topped with ribbed onion domes and numerous chattris.
  • Fusion of Forms: Extensively utilizes Mughal elements like the multi-cusped arch, the ribbed dome, and intricate floral frescoes, while integrating Hindu Rajput elements like the projecting balcony (jharokha).

Mughal Architecture

Developing in the Indian subcontinent under the Mughal Empire (16th to 18th centuries), this style represents an exquisite synthesis of Islamic, Persian, Turkic, and indigenous Indian architectural traditions.

Key Features of Mughal Architecture

  • Symmetry and Balance: Strict adherence to bilateral symmetry and immense scale (e.g., the Taj Mahal complex).
  • Onion Domes (Amrud): Widespread use of bulbous, double-shell domes topped with an inverted lotus finial.
  • Iwan: A prominent, vaulted portal opening onto a courtyard, typically framed by intricate calligraphy and geometric patterns.
  • Chattri: Elevated, dome-shaped pavilions used as an architectural ornament on roofs and corners, blending Hindu Rajput elements with Islamic design.
  • Pietra Dura (Parchin Kari): Incredibly intricate stone inlay work, embedding semi-precious stones (like lapis lazuli, jade, and carnelian) into white marble to create highly detailed floral motifs.
  • Mughal Gardens (Charbagh): The profound importance of the four-part paradise garden layout in Mughal tombs and palaces. The Charbagh is divided by intersecting water channels representing the four rivers of paradise, with the tomb often placed exactly at the central intersection (e.g., Humayun's Tomb) or at the end of the axis (e.g., the Taj Mahal).

Primary Islamic Typologies

Beyond the mosque, Islamic society developed specific, highly refined building types to serve civic, educational, and funerary purposes.

Key Architectural Typologies

  • The Madrasa: An Islamic educational institution or college. Architecturally, it is typically centered around a large open courtyard (often featuring a central fountain) surrounded by vaulted arcades (iwans) that serve as lecture halls, with smaller adjoining cells acting as student dormitories.
  • The Caravanserai: A fortified roadside inn crucial for the safe and efficient operation of ancient trade routes like the Silk Road. They featured a massive, defensible outer wall with a single monumental entrance, enclosing a large courtyard where merchants, their animals (camels, horses), and goods could rest securely.
  • The Mausoleum (Qubba/Turbah): A monumental tomb built to honor prominent figures, rulers, or saints. While early Islam discouraged elaborate graves, the mausoleum became a major architectural form, typically characterized by a centralized, square base topped with an imposing dome (e.g., the Samanid Mausoleum in Bukhara or the Taj Mahal).

Southeast Asian Architecture

Influenced significantly by Indian religious frameworks (Hinduism and Buddhism) spread via maritime trade routes, Southeast Asian architecture adapted these concepts into unprecedented monumental expressions, deeply integrated with local cosmologies, dense jungle environments, and sophisticated water management systems.

Key Features of Southeast Asian Architecture

  • Temple Mountains: Grand structures designed to represent Mount Meru, the sacred five-peaked mountain of Hindu, Jain, and Buddhist cosmology. They typically employ a stepped pyramid form combined with towering spires.
  • Angkor Wat (Khmer Empire, Cambodia): The ultimate expression of the "temple mountain" and a masterpiece of hydraulic engineering. Built by Suryavarman II in the 12th century, it is oriented to the west (unusual for Hindu temples, suggesting it was also a funerary temple). It features a vast moat representing the cosmic ocean, a massive outer wall, and three rectangular galleries enclosing a central quincunx of towers (representing Mount Meru's peaks). Its extensive bas-reliefs narrate Hindu epics and historical processions.
  • Borobudur (Sailendra Dynasty, Indonesia): The world's largest Buddhist temple, constructed in the 9th century on Java. It is designed as a massive, single stupa built over a natural hill, functioning as a three-dimensional mandala (a spiritual map). Pilgrims circumambulate the monument, ascending through three symbolic realms of Buddhist cosmology (Kamadhatu, Rupadhatu, and Arupadhatu), moving past miles of narrative reliefs towards the summit crowned with 72 openwork stupas housing Buddha statues and a large central, empty stupa representing Nirvana.
  • Hydraulic Cities: Large-scale religious and royal complexes were often integrated with vast networks of reservoirs (barays), moats, and canals, serving both symbolic functions (representing cosmic oceans) and practical agricultural needs.
  • Intricate Bas-Reliefs: Extensive, detailed stone carvings covering massive galleries, depicting religious epics (like the Ramayana and Mahabharata), celestial beings (apsaras), and historical events.
  • Syncretism: A blending of imported Indian architectural forms and religious iconography with indigenous animistic beliefs and ancestor worship.

Angkor Wat: Temple Mountain & Hydraulic City

Angkor Wat symbolizes the Hindu cosmos. The central towers represent Mount Meru (home of the gods), the outer walls represent the mountains enclosing the world, and the vast moat represents the cosmic ocean. The moat also served a critical structural function, keeping the sandy soil stable.

Adjust the water level. During the monsoon, the moat fills, preventing the enormous stone structure from sinking by stabilizing the groundwater level in the sandy foundation beneath the temple.

Pagan (Bagan) Architecture (Myanmar)

  • The Stupa Forest: Located on the Irrawaddy plain, the capital of the Pagan Kingdom witnessed a massive proliferation of over 10,000 Buddhist temples, pagodas, and monasteries built between the 11th and 13th centuries.
  • Brick Construction: In contrast to the heavy stone of Angkor, Pagan architecture is characterized by its masterful use of fired brick covered in intricate stucco. Structures like the Ananda Temple feature a centralized, symmetrical plan, towering sikhara-like finials, and perfectly proportioned arch/vault construction that rivals later European gothic engineering in its lightness and spanning capabilities.

Chinese Architecture

Chinese architecture represents one of the world's most enduring and continuous building traditions. It is characterized by its strict adherence to axial symmetry, hierarchical courtyard planning, and a highly sophisticated, earthquake-resistant timber frame system.

Key Features of Chinese Architecture

  • The Timber Frame (Jian): The fundamental building block is a standardized rectangular spatial unit (jian) defined by timber columns. The structure relies on a complex system of interlocking wooden brackets called dougong to support deep, overhanging, sweeping roofs without the need for load-bearing walls.
  • Dougong: Intricate, mortarless bracket clusters that transfer the heavy weight of the roof onto the columns, providing crucial flexibility that absorbs seismic shocks.
  • Axial Planning and Courtyards: Buildings are arranged symmetrically along a north-south axis, reflecting Confucian ideals of order, hierarchy, and familial duty. The most important buildings face south. Enclosed courtyards (siheyuan) provide privacy and climate control.
  • Feng Shui: The ancient practice of geomancy used to orient buildings harmoniously with nature and invisible energy forces (qi), dictating that buildings should be protected by hills to the north and face water to the south.
  • The Pagoda vs. The Stupa: As Buddhism spread from India to China via the Silk Road, the architectural form of the reliquary transformed dramatically. The Indian stupa—a massive, solid, hemispherical earth-and-stone mound designed solely for exterior circumambulation—was fused with the native Chinese multi-story watchtower (lou). The resulting pagoda is a tall, multi-tiered structure with distinctive sweeping eaves, offering interior accessible space on multiple levels (though often retaining a central pillar housing relics).
  • Monumental Fortifications: Built over centuries, the Great Wall of China is a massive defensive system featuring formidable rammed earth and brick walls following rugged topography, integrated with watchtowers and barracks.
  • Imperial Palaces (The Forbidden City): The paramount example of strict axial planning, hierarchical courtyards, and Ming/Qing dynasty timber construction. Enclosed by massive red walls, the complex was the political and ritual center of the empire, heavily adorned with symbolic yellow roof tiles (reserved for the emperor).

Chinese Roof Typologies and Cosmology

  • The Sweeping Roof: A deeply curved, dramatic roofline that swoops upward at the corners, designed not merely for aesthetics but to repel heavy rains far from the timber walls while allowing winter sunlight to penetrate deep into the courtyard.
  • Hip Roof (Wudian): The most prestigious roof type, reserved exclusively for the emperor and high-ranking deities, featuring a single prominent ridge and four sloping sides without gables.
  • Resting Mountain Roof (Xieshan): A hybrid half-hipped, half-gabled roof, highly complex to construct, widely used for important temples and palaces slightly lower in status than the pure hip roof.
  • Bagua (Eight Trigrams): The fundamental concept of Taoist cosmology representing the fundamental principles of reality, heavily influencing traditional Chinese urban planning, feng shui orientation, and the symmetrical, octagonal layouts of specific sacred spaces (like the Temple of Heaven in Beijing).

Dougong

A unique structural element of interlocking wooden brackets in traditional Chinese architecture used to support the overhanging roof while providing seismic flexibility.

Japanese Architecture

Japanese architecture, while heavily influenced by Chinese precedents, developed a distinct aesthetic characterized by deep reverence for nature (rooted in Shintoism), minimalism, asymmetry, and an extraordinary sensitivity to materials, particularly unpainted wood and paper.

Key Features of Japanese Architecture

  • Shinto Shrines (Ise Jingu): Structures characterized by profound simplicity, thatched roofs, unpainted wood, and harmony with the natural environment. The Ise Grand Shrine (Ise Jingu), the holiest Shinto site, practices Shikinen Sengu—the ritual rebuilding of the exact same structure on an adjacent site every 20 years, symbolizing spiritual purification, impermanence, and the passing of carpentry skills across generations.
  • Modularity (Tatami): The layout of traditional Japanese homes (minka) and palaces is strictly governed by the dimensions of the tatami mat (roughly 3x6 feet), creating highly proportional and flexible interior spaces.
  • Fluid Boundaries: The use of sliding screens (shoji, made of translucent paper, and fusuma, opaque) instead of solid walls allows interior spaces to be continuously reconfigured and blurs the boundary between the interior and the surrounding garden.
  • Zen Gardens (Karesansui): Dry landscape gardens using raked sand and carefully placed rocks to represent water and mountains, designed for deep meditation rather than recreation.

Japanese Sacred Spaces

  • Torii Gate: A traditional Japanese gate most commonly found at the entrance of or within a Shinto shrine, symbolically marking the transition from the mundane to the sacred space of the kami (spirits). It typically consists of two vertical posts topped with a horizontal lintel.
  • Kondo (Golden Hall): The main hall of a Buddhist temple complex containing the principal objects of worship (statues of the Buddha). It is generally single-storied but designed to appear double-storied due to a surrounding pent roof (mokoshi).
  • The Japanese Pagoda: Evolving from the Indian stupa, it is a multi-tiered timber tower (usually 3 or 5 stories) designed purely as a reliquary, not for congregational worship. Its massive central pillar (shinbashira) is highly flexible, providing incredible resistance to earthquakes by allowing the individual stories to sway independently.

Japanese Castles (Shiro)

Driven by the constant warfare of the Sengoku period (15th-16th centuries), the Japanese developed highly sophisticated defensive architecture combining massive stone foundations with multi-story, heavily armed timber superstructures.

Key Features of Japanese Defensive Architecture

  • Stone Foundations (Ishigaki): Massive, sloping, curved stone bases (built without mortar) designed to withstand earthquakes and artillery fire.
  • The Keep (Tenshu): The towering, multi-tiered central wooden command structure, characterized by complex, sweeping tile roofs (e.g., Himeji Castle, the "White Heron").
  • Defensive Mazes: Complex, spiraling layouts of gates and courtyards intended to confuse and trap attacking armies in crossfire zones before they could reach the central keep.
  • White Plaster Walls: Thick, fire-resistant white plaster applied over a lattice of bamboo and clay, protecting the flammable timber structure inside.

Korean and Tibetan Architecture

While influenced by neighboring China and India, the architectures of Korea and Tibet developed highly distinct, culturally specific forms tailored to their unique environments and spiritual traditions.

Key Features of Korean Architecture

  • Harmony with Nature: Buildings are carefully sited to harmonize with the natural topography rather than dominating it, embodying the principle of pungsu (geomancy).
  • Hanok: The traditional Korean house, distinguished by its gently curved tiled roof and the integration of ondol (underfloor heating) and maru (cooling wooden floors).
  • Buddhist Temples: Mountain temples like Bulguksa showcase exquisite woodwork and stone pagodas, characterized by a sense of quiet restraint and balance.

Key Features of Tibetan Architecture

  • Fortress-Palaces (Dzongs): Massive, imposing structures with battered (inward-sloping) stone walls, combining administrative and monastic functions. The most iconic example is the sprawling Potala Palace in Lhasa.
  • Adaptation to Altitude: Thick masonry walls, small windows, and flat roofs are employed to withstand the harsh, high-altitude climate of the Himalayas.
  • Vibrant Interiors: In stark contrast to the austere, earth-toned exteriors, interiors are vividly painted with elaborate Buddhist iconography and vibrant colors.

Islamic Architecture

Islamic architecture spans a vast geographic area from Spain to Southeast Asia. It is unified not by a single structural system or material, but by shared religious requirements (the mosque), spiritual aesthetics emphasizing infinity and geometry over human representation, and the rapid assimilation and perfection of regional building techniques (Roman, Byzantine, Persian).

Key Features of Islamic Architecture

  • The Arch and Vault: Mastery and extreme elaboration of arches, notably the pointed arch (which predates the Gothic), the horseshoe arch (Moorish Spain), the multifoil arch, and the complex, honeycomb-like muqarnas vaulting used to transition from square walls to circular domes.
  • Aniconism and Ornamentation: Because depicting sentient beings is generally avoided in religious contexts (aniconism), Islamic architecture developed unparalleled mastery in three areas of surface decoration: complex geometric patterns, stylized floral motifs (arabesque), and sweeping Arabic calligraphy (often Quranic verses).
  • Water and Paradise Gardens: Water is a critical element, physically for ablution and cooling, and symbolically representing the rivers of Paradise in enclosed, geometrically divided courtyard gardens (chahar bagh).

Anatomy of a Mosque

  • Mihrab: A semi-circular niche in the wall of a mosque indicating the qibla, the direction of the Kaaba in Mecca, toward which Muslims pray.
  • Minbar: A short flight of steps used as a pulpit by the imam (prayer leader) during Friday prayers, invariably located to the right of the mihrab.
  • Sahn: The central courtyard, an essential element for communal gathering and ablution, featuring a central fountain.
  • Minaret: A slender tower from which the muezzin calls the faithful to prayer five times a day.
  • Dikka: An elevated platform (often wooden) within the prayer hall where the muezzin repeats the imam's prayers so the entire congregation can hear them.
  • Maqsura: An enclosed, protected area near the mihrab, historically reserved for rulers or dignitaries to protect them from assassins during prayer.
  • Iwan: A rectangular hall or space, usually vaulted, walled on three sides, with one end entirely open to a courtyard. Originating in pre-Islamic Persia, it became a fundamental component of the classic four-iwan mosque layout.

Primary Mosque Typologies

  • The Hypostyle Mosque: The earliest form (e.g., the Great Mosque of Kairouan or the Great Mosque of Cordoba), inspired by the Prophet Muhammad's house. It features a vast, flat-roofed prayer hall supported by a dense forest of columns, often enclosing a large central courtyard.
  • The Four-Iwan Mosque: Developed in Persia (e.g., the Great Mosque of Isfahan), it replaces the flat hypostyle hall with a central courtyard surrounded by four massive, vaulted halls (iwans) on each side, with the largest indicating the direction of Mecca.
  • The Central-Dome Mosque: Perfected by the Ottomans (e.g., the Süleymaniye Mosque by Sinan), deeply influenced by Byzantine architecture like the Hagia Sophia. It features a massive, soaring central dome supported by semi-domes, creating a vast, unified, column-free interior space.

Regional Islamic Styles

While unified by religious requirements and core decorative motifs, Islamic architecture developed highly distinct regional expressions based on local climates, materials, and pre-existing cultural traditions.

Moorish Architecture (Al-Andalus)

  • The Alhambra (Granada): The pinnacle of Moorish palace architecture in Spain. It is essentially a fortress enclosing a series of delicate, incredibly ornate palace courtyards (e.g., the Court of the Lions). It perfectly exemplifies the Islamic concept of paradise on earth, featuring intricate muqarnas stucco ceilings, continuously flowing water channels, and lush courtyard gardens.
  • The Horseshoe Arch: An architectural hallmark heavily utilized in Moorish Spain, characterized by an arch that pinches inward above the capitals before forming a semi-circle, often highlighted with alternating colored bricks (voussoirs), famously seen in the Great Mosque of Cordoba.

Major Regional Styles

  • Moorish Architecture (Al-Andalus/Spain & North Africa): Flourishing under the Umayyads, it is characterized by the widespread use of the horseshoe arch, alternating red and white brick voussoirs (e.g., the Great Mosque of Córdoba), highly elaborate stucco decoration (yesería), and complex, inward-facing courtyard palaces with intricate water features (e.g., the Alhambra).
  • Ottoman Architecture (Turkey & the Balkans): Heavily influenced by Byzantine architecture (particularly Hagia Sophia), Ottoman design is defined by massive, central, hemispherical domes cascading downwards through smaller semi-domes, creating vast, unified interior spaces. It features exceptionally tall, pencil-thin minarets (e.g., the Blue Mosque and the works of the master architect Mimar Sinan).
  • Persian/Timurid Architecture (Iran & Central Asia): Defined by immense, towering iwans facing vast courtyards (the four-iwan plan), prominent bulbous or double-shell domes, and the overwhelming, vibrant use of complex geometric glazed tilework covering entire exterior surfaces (e.g., the Shah Mosque in Isfahan).
  • Mamluk and Fatimid Architecture (Egypt): Centered in Cairo, the Mamluks (a warrior caste) and earlier Fatimids developed a highly distinctive monumental style. It is characterized by the extensive use of ablaq (alternating bands of light and dark stone masonry), incredibly complex carved stone domes with geometric and arabesque patterns, and massive, fortress-like, multi-functional madrasa-mausoleum complexes built into the dense urban fabric (e.g., the Mosque-Madrasa of Sultan Hassan).

Concept:

Islamic architecture shuns figurative representation (aniconism) in religious spaces. Instead, it relies on complex, infinite geometric patterns (girih), stylized vegetative motifs (arabesque), and calligraphy for profound spiritual expression.

These interlacing strapwork patterns are generated from a basic grid of polygons (often squares and hexagons) tessellated across surfaces, symbolizing the infinite nature and underlying order of the universe created by God.

Important

A defining contrast between Western and Eastern architectural traditions lies in structural ideology: Western monumental architecture historically prioritized rigid, heavy, load-bearing stone masonry striving for permanence, whereas East Asian architecture mastered the flexible, earthquake-resilient timber frame, accepting impermanence and relying on periodic reconstruction.
